博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
使用Cygwin和 mingw 安装 python paramiko模块
阅读量:6768 次
发布时间:2019-06-26

本文共 1172 字,大约阅读时间需要 3 分钟。

hot3.png

1. 所需软件包

  python    

  paramiko  

  Cygwin  http://cygwin.com/setup.exe
  pycrypto http://ftp.dlitz.net/pub/dlitz/crypto/pycrypto/pycrypto-2.6.tar.gz

  mingw   

2. 安装 python   (忽略)

3. 安装mingw ,如果本地没有gcc 则需要安装这个。下载后的exe文件进行网络安装,假设目录为C:\mingw,在PATH中加入 C:\mingw\bin,并在c:\python24\lib\distutils下新建一个名称是distutils.cfg的文件,填入:

[build] compiler=mingw32

4. 安装Cygwin

下载后的exe文件进行网络安装 ,这里我们需要选择deve包里的 binutils 其他的可以不选

5. 安装PyCrypto

  • 解压缩
  • 在dos下进入解压缩的目录,运行
    python setup.py buildpython setup.py install

    在执行 python setup.py build 如果提示-mno-cygwin错误请修改python安装目录,找到/lib/distutils/cygwinccompiler.py 大致在308行 自己查找一下 把-mno-cygwin(红色部分)删除,就行了。
    self.set_executables(compiler='gcc -mno-cygwin -O -Wall',                             compiler_so='gcc -mno-cygwin -mdll -O -Wall',                             compiler_cxx='g++ -mno-cygwin -O -Wall',                             linker_exe='gcc -mno-cygwin',                             linker_so='%s -mno-cygwin %s %s'

    同时删除cygwinccompiler.pyc文件
  • 安装测试 dos 窗口输入 
    pythonimport Crypto

     没有错误提示说明安装成功! 

  

6 . 安装  paramiko 

  • 解压缩
  • 在dos下进 入解压缩的目录,运行
    python setup.py buildpython setup.py install

  • 测试安装
    • pythonimport paramiko

         没有错误提示说明安装成功!

 最后祝你好运!

转载于:https://my.oschina.net/yangqijun/blog/78621

你可能感兴趣的文章
BroadcastReceiver应用详解
查看>>
利用IPv6进行远程桌面连接
查看>>
DBCP连接池参数详解-2.4.0版本
查看>>
DISQL你不知道的小秘密之“disql pagesize”设置
查看>>
Linux软链接与硬链接
查看>>
我的友情链接
查看>>
关于将一个字符串转换为整数的问题
查看>>
以太坊构建DApps系列教程(三):编译部署测试TNS代币
查看>>
论文:论信息系统项目的范围管理
查看>>
三消小游戏悟人生大道理
查看>>
Android显示还不错的EditText
查看>>
ssh 的简介与使用
查看>>
DNS服务委派
查看>>
计算机linux系统 第一课
查看>>
CSS @font-face规则 引用外部服务器字体
查看>>
Spring Boot入门初体验(1)--Maven创建Spring Boot项目(超详细)
查看>>
android:largeHeap属性
查看>>
Linux学习笔记之 RPM包管理、Yum安装,配置及使用
查看>>
我的友情链接
查看>>
我的友情链接
查看>>